Summary
This summary covers five available inspections for SANTANA FAMILY CHILD CARE from March 4, 2024 through April 7, 2025.
Two inspections recorded violations, with six recorded violations in total.
The most recent higher-concern violation was on February 5, 2025 and involved background screening, with a due date of February 6, 2025.
That higher-concern topic showed up in two inspections.
Two later inspections, from February 19, 2025 through April 7, 2025, showed no recorded violations, but the records do not say whether they were formal follow-ups.

Medium concern: Staff training
Report finding
Personnel Requirements (c) The licensee and other personnel as specified shall complete training on preventive health practices, including pediatric cardiopulmonary resuscitation and pediatric first aid, pursuant to Health and Safety Code Section 1596.866. This requirement is not met as evidenced by: Based on record review the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that Licensee and 2 staff missing the correct pediatric infant cpr which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
Correction status
Plan of correction due by February 19, 2025

Medium concern: Health or food records
Report finding
General Provisions and Definitions (1) Commencing September 1, 2016, a person shall not be employed or volunteer at a family day care home if he or she has not been immunized against influenza, pertussis, and measles. Each employee and volunteer shall receive an influenza vaccination between August 1 and December 1 of each year. This requirement is not met as evidenced by: Based on record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that Licensee and 2 staff missing missing measles, t-dap, which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
Correction status
Plan of correction due by February 26, 2025

Higher concern: Sleep safety
Report finding
Infant Safe Sleep An Individual Infant Sleeping Plan [LIC 9227 (3/20)] shall be completed for each infant up to 12 months of age the provider has in care and included in the infant's file at the facility. The Individual Infant Sleeping Plan [LIC 9227 (3/20)] shall be maintained in the infant’s file and shall be available to the Department for review. This requirement is not met as evidenced by: Based on record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that 2 infants are missing lic 9227 which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
Correction status
Plan of correction due by February 19, 2025
